What is nanoCAD?
nanoCAD is a pro-grade 2D CAD system with native DWG support and full customizability. It is totally free, for business, professional, or personal purposes. It is fast, lightweight, capable, and , unlike most free CAD programs, completely uncrippled. nanoCAD includes:
- Classic CAD interface. Any engineer could easily master nanoCAD since everything is in their right places: menu, button icons, panels, command line, and the commands theirselves are easily recognizable. This makes nanoCAD easy to migrate to since enterprise needs no time to retrain its engineers.
- Native *.dwg support. The world’s most popular file format for technical documentation - *.dwg – is the nanoCAD native file format. Project created using nanoCAD and saved as *.dwg file could be easily opened and edited in any CAD application supporting *.dwg which in turn makes nanoCAD perfect tool for project collaboration and sharing.
- Ultimate design tool. nanoCAD includes all necessary tools required for basic design and allows creating and editing 2D and 3D vector primitives, texts, tables, blocks, graphical technical documentation display and print settings using either a model or a sheet.
Open API and application development
nanoCAD has a traditional CAD application programming interface (API) that allows developing independent nanoCAD based applications and additional automation modules.
